Salas O’Brien is an employee-owned engineering and professional services firm dedicated to creating positive impact for clients and the world. They are seeking an experienced Electrical Design Engineer to design building electrical systems, particularly for healthcare projects, while providing opportunities for professional growth and leadership responsibilities.

Responsibilities

  • Develop electrical system designs in accordance with project scope, client requirements, applicable codes, and industry standards
  • Provide engineering planning, design, and construction administration services for: Power distribution systems, Lighting and lighting control systems, Fire alarm systems, Nurse Call systems, Other low voltage systems
  • Perform existing building surveys and document current electrical and fire alarm conditions
  • Prepare, edit, and coordinate electrical specifications and construction documents
  • Author engineering reports, assessment reports, and Basis of Design (BOD) documents
  • Coordinate closely with internal project teams, architects, and other engineering disciplines
  • Participate in and lead technical discussions, design coordination meetings, and client presentations
  • Support construction administration activities, including RFIs, submittal reviews, and field coordination as needed
  • Assist Project Managers with technical input, schedule coordination, and project execution

Skills

  • Bachelor's or master's degree in electrical engineering or a related field
  • Minimum of 5 years of electrical design experience
  • Proficiency in electrical engineering calculations, including: Lighting photometric calculations, Voltage drop analysis, Short‑circuit and overcurrent protection coordination studies, Load Calculations
  • Proficient in Revit, AutoCAD, and Microsoft Office
  • Strong working knowledge of applicable electrical codes, standards, and design guidelines
  • High level of attention to detail with a commitment to quality and accuracy
  • Excellent work ethic with a proactive, solution‑oriented attitude
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Effective time management and organizational skills with the ability to prioritize and manage multiple tasks
  • Ability to work independently with minimal supervision as well as collaboratively within a multidisciplinary team
  • Comfortable engaging with clients and presenting technical information in a clear and professional manner
  • Experience with healthcare, science and technology, education, and/or commercial buildings is strongly preferred
  • Knowledge of and experience with HCAI / OSHPD standards is a plus
  • Professional Engineer (PE) license preferred
  • LEED accreditation or sustainable design experience preferred
